Elk River <br /> Municipal Utilities UTILITIES COMMISSION MEETING <br /> TO: FROM: <br /> Elk River Municipal Utilities Commission Wade Lovelette—Technical Services <br /> John Dietz—Chair Superintendent <br /> Al Nadeau—Vice Chair <br /> Daryl Thompson—Trustee <br /> MEETING DATE: AGENDA ITEM NUMBER: <br /> February 11, 2014 5.2 <br /> SUBJECT: <br /> 2013 Electric Reliability Report <br /> BACKGROUND: <br /> Minnesota Rules Chapter 7826 Public Utilities Commission Electric Utility Standards cover <br /> safety, reliability, service, and reporting requirements. Per 7826.0100(A), municipal utilities are <br /> exempt from these requirements. However, the Elk River Municipal Utilities Commission <br /> adopted a number of parts of this chapter as a Distribution Reliability Standard policy requiring <br /> annual reporting on system reliability. <br /> DISCUSSION: <br /> In 2013, our reliability index numbers remain excellent. These reliability index numbers reflect <br /> the condition of our robust electrical system as well as the superb response time from our local <br /> line crews. This also reflects the local accountability, long term visioning on system design, and <br /> ongoing system maintenance. The table below reflects the number of customer outage minutes <br /> from 2004 through 2013. <br /> Year #of Customers # of Outage Minutes # of Outages <br /> 2004 7773 393,926 84 <br /> 2005 8398 558,140 59 <br /> 2006 8804 314,510 73 <br /> 2007 9163 67,845 47 <br /> 2008 9067 155,768 57 <br /> 2009 9170 46,706 49 <br /> 2010 9207 526,144 77 <br /> 2011 9576 297,359 51 <br /> 2012 9285 71,496 57 <br /> 2013 9285 55,451 31 <br /> 1 NI <br /> rerEeEe et <br /> Page1of4 <br /> NATURE <br /> Reliable Public <br /> Power Provider POWERED To SERVE <br /> 175 <br />
